Introduction of the Hammer Museum
If you're trying to find a special social experience in Los Angeles, the Hammer Museum is a must-visit location. Nestled in Westwood, this modern art museum offers a mix of innovative exhibits and appealing programs. You'll value the museum's dedication to showcasing both developed and emerging artists, making it a hub for imaginative exploration.
As you wander with its galleries, you'll come across provocative installments and a vibrant atmosphere that invites conversation and reflection. The Hammer likewise holds lectures, film screenings, and performances that improve your understanding of contemporary culture.
Admission is totally free, so you can check out without breaking the bank. Plus, the museum's architecture is a treat, combining modern-day style with a welcoming atmosphere. Whether you're an art enthusiast or just starting your journey, the Hammer Museum offers something for everyone, guaranteeing a memorable addition to your L.A. itinerary.

Building Highlights of the Museum
The Hammer Museum's architectural layout is as charming as its shows, inviting visitors to discover not simply the art within however the space itself. The building flawlessly mixes contemporary and classic components, showcasing a striking combination of concrete, glass, and steel. As you approach, take a minute to appreciate the museum's inviting façade, which features a huge, open plaza that motivates social interaction.
Inside, the airy galleries give a feeling of flexibility, allowing you to value the art from different perspectives. The all-natural light floodings the exhibit spaces, enhancing the shades and appearances of the artworks. Don't miss out on the spectacular main courtyard, a serene sanctuary decorated with lavish greenery, excellent for a moment of representation.
The Hammer's thoughtful style not just improves your experience yet likewise stresses the connection in between art and design, making it a must-see location in Los Angeles.

Frequently Asked Concerns
Is There an Admission Charge for the Hammer Museum?
Yes, there's no admission fee for the Hammer Museum. You can appreciate all the exhibitions and programs without investing a penny, making it an easily accessible spot for art enthusiasts like you. Appreciate your check out!
Are Guided Tours Available for Visitors?
Yes, assisted tours are readily available for visitors. You can sign up with these trips to discover the museum's exhibits comprehensive, enhancing your experience. Make sure to inspect the timetable for times and availability when you check out.
Can I Bring Food and Drinks Inside the Museum?
You can't bring food and drinks inside the museum. Nonetheless, there are designated locations nearby where you can appreciate your snacks and drinks prior to or after exploring the exhibitions. Enjoy your see!
Is Photography Allowed Within the Museum Galleries?
You can take pictures in specific locations of the museum, but be sure to look for any particular limitations. Blink digital photography and tripods are usually restricted, so keep it straightforward and considerate of the art work.
